IIRC the 991.1 C2S / GTS (not sure about 3.4) already have the OEM 82mm throttle body, so it would just be the core exchange?
Dundon offers some kind of 93mm throttle body for the GT cars
https://www.drivingdynamicsmotorspor...air-intake-kit
The engine in the new 991 remains relatively unchanged from the previous 997.2 Carrera. The 991 Carrera continues to employs the 82mm throttle body just like the Carrera before it. This means there is no "Competition Plenum" available since the 82mm TB is still the largest TB available from Porsche.
